Output 2159efaa4efd29fdc30999cddc39059286916189deaef765dfa7ad0db67e6785:321

value
3157683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19bea755c3ffb9073a5b76464c9e45234d09e711 OP_EQUAL
address
3439DBq4fD3bjZsTppSW9BG28PymwWjscQ
transaction
2159efaa4efd29fdc30999cddc39059286916189deaef765dfa7ad0db67e6785
spent
true